First of all, I hate split stays. But since we somehow snagged 3 nights in a BCV studio, followed by 4 nights in a BCV 1 BR, followed by 1 night in a BWV 1 BR it was worth it.

We arrived on December 27 just before 10:00p and got our resort mugs and then headed to our room to get unpacked and relax before dozing off.

The first morning was Magic Kingdom. We drove our rental car to the TTC and would return it after we were done at the park. We had great luck at MK and rope dropped Pan and got several rides done, all before 9:30 in the morning (it was a 7:30 opening). Great....let's go back to the TTC and get the rental car over to Alamo. Hmm....the express monorail is roped off......so is the ferry boat. So we started on the long walk to the TTC and explored the new tower along the way. Once finally getting to the car we headed to Alamo and returned it and hopped in the shuttle to go back to BCV. Took all of 2 minutes to drop it off and get in the shuttle.

I honestly don't remember a lot of specifics of the rest of the trip, but we focused mostly on Epcot and HS. We did Multipass every day and found it worth the money even if there was not a lot to choose from mid-day. We also did the quickservice dining plan for the first 2 parts of the split and "beat" it by a good $100+. Didn't expect that to happen.

Now, onto the changeover days. On changeover day #1 we went to the Beach Club lobby at 6:15a (we were going to AK) and had them check us out and she immediately assigned us a new room. It was unoccupied already but needed to be cleaned. We got the room ready text at 11:06 a.m. For a 1 BR to be ready that early I was quite happy. Then on changeover day #2 we wheeled our luggage to the Beach Club lobby and made sure they checked us out. This was at about 6:30a. We then wheeled our bags over to Boardwalk to get checked in. Same deal -- they got us an unoccupied room that needed to be cleaned. They were confused how we got to the resort w/o going through the security gate at the front, so we had to explain that bit. At any rate, that room was ready at 11:02a. If splits always go that way I would have no problem with them.....
